Association Forum of Chicagoland Foundation

Founded in 1916, the Association Forum of Chicagoland is the “association of associations” in Chicago. Forum has 4,000+ members who represent more than 44,000 association professionals from nearly 1,600 Chicago organizations. The mission of the Forum is to advance the professional practice of association management.

In late 2015, the Association Forum of Chicagoland Foundation partnered with ADS to conduct a comprehensive feasibility and planning study. The purpose of the study was to explore opportunities to revitalize and refocus the Foundation as the Forum prepared to celebrate its 100th anniversary. Through the Study, ADS captured valuable insights and provided tangible recommendations that will aid the Forum as it makes important decisions on future strategies for delivering value to its members, industry, and the greater association management community.
